Desktop IT Support Admin

Here are some points of the tasks for the IT Person:
Maintain, manage, and administrate the company's main software systems. Those include the below ones, but it is not limited only to the ones below. Office 365 (Emails, Microsoft Office, Drive, Antivirus, Teams, IVR, other office services) Azure Azure DevOps Adobe Udemy Postman ASC Systems Mural Clickatel Plumvoice Ringcentral and DropBox HubSpot KeePass Other Softwares Provide company members with Support and training in installing, setting up, and resolving issues with all the above software systems but is not limited only to the below. Setting up processes and procedures, and policing and enforcing IT Policy for company IT services and software. Cyber security measures Help Desk Support Manage cost and updates required for systems and softwares related to IT work. Equipment procurement, management and support. Support all Windows OS related requests to the company users.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
